今天來聊聊運維該如何修煉

zhs1994發表於2018-07-28

什麼是“鐵飯碗”,放在父母那一輩就是國企、央企、事業單位這些拿得出手的工作,但是 在這個現如今的網際網路高速發展的時代,“鐵飯碗” 無疑最穩妥的自然就是選擇一門任何時代,都不會落伍的技能。 如何才能保持住一門鐵的飯碗,那就需要深入學習研究。 不得不說,當下時代唯有一定的經濟能力,才可穩當的在這個社會上立足。

我選擇的是Linux運維,大家可能覺得Linux這樣話題比較普通,但是它是一門 發展延伸了很多年且越來越火的技能, 唯有將Linux運維這部功法修煉到至高境界。才有拿到高薪的機會。

首先先給大家看一下Linux運維工程師必備技能:

  1. Linux系統基礎

  2. 網路服務

  3. Shell指令碼語言

  4. 資料庫

  5. 防火牆

  6. 監控工具

  7. 叢集於熱備

  8. 資料備份

  9. 文字處理

  10. 正規表示式

然後在這裡給大家羅列出 幾條Linux運維修煉心經:

1、從思維上擺脫傳統Windows系統思維模式。

相信絕大部分人使用計算機時所接觸到的首個作業系統仍然是Windows系列作業系統,而且可能在接觸Linux作業系統之前已經使用了很長時間的Windows系統作業系統了。這樣,就很容易在我們的腦海裡形式Windows系統作業系統的操作習慣和思維習慣。

雖說Linux和Windows均是作業系統,功能上沒有太大的差別。但是,Linux的操作習慣和思維方式與Windows還是有很大差別的。如,筆者第一次安裝好“藍點”後就為找不到D盤而疑惑。同時,筆者接觸到Linux新手大部分都有一個習慣:學習Linux習慣於在圖形化介面上操作,估計就是受Windows影響的緣故。

2、多動手,勤於實踐。

本人也經常遇到初學者問我有什麼好的方法學好Linux。我基本上每次都類似回答他們:沒有什麼好辦法,只有多動手,勤於實踐。學習計算機有一個非常好的優勢就是,你測試環境下或虛擬機器上搞測試不需要太擔心把機器搞壞,即使把系統搞壞了,大不了重灌系統就是了。

計算機方面的知識很多都是非常抽象的,很多時候如果我們只是看書,往往是看得雲裡霧裡,只有透過不斷的實踐,測試,驗證才能真正搞懂一個概念。

3、要有不畏懼困難和強烈的研究精神。

經常看到許多新手一遇到問題就論壇上去發帖,向高手求教。而且許多時候這些人似乎要求所謂的高手擁有靈丹妙藥,對於他們的問題給出詳細的解決方法甚至完善的步驟。其實這是最要不得的對待問題的態度。雖然,高手給我們提供的解決問題的建議或許對我們有很大的參考價值,但是僅僅只能作為參考,我們不能不加思考的照搬他們的方法。

4、善於整理和總結

知識是要透過不斷的整理和總結才能升化和系列化的。當我們每次遇到問題時,都能記錄當時的場景以及解決方法,隨著我們學習的不斷深入,那麼我們所積累的知識也就越來越豐富。

5、要有很強的責任心和使命感。

基本上運維是系統對外提供服務的最後的把關者。因此,一個系統對使用者來說是不是穩定跟運維有很大的關係。特別是,當系統不出現問題的時候,許多運維都不重視容災備份和資料安全,這樣一旦系統出現了故障,系統的恢復就需要花很長的時間。

6、要有不斷的學習精神

計算機的發展真是太快了,新的知識、新的技術層出不窮。如果不持續的保持不斷學習,那麼很快知識就會老化,跟不上時代發展的需要。

7、要有精益求精的精神

應該說運維的工作的彈性還是很大的。即可以非常粗造的運維一個系統,也可以持續改進、最佳化系統,使系統越來越高效的執行。而如何讓一個系統越來越高效的執行,就需要我們具有精益求精的精神,持繼地進行改進。

這幾條裡,最重要的是第2和第4條,一定要養成動手和總結的習慣!

除此之外,瞭解一下職位的必須技能,在學習的時候針對性的進行強化。去一些招聘網站,蒐集一下運維工程師的職位要求,將這些職位要求進行彙總後,得出一條學習路線。學習最忌心焦氣燥,調整一下心態,多和同道交流,爭取早日成為一名Linux運維工程師!


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/31546605/viewspace-2168539/,如需轉載,請註明出處,否則將追究法律責任。

相關文章